Overview

Glow’s core product enables podcasters to create paid subscriptions by building a subscription page where creators accept payments and enable listeners to access paywalled content from the podcast app of their choice. The company began testing with the startup-focused podcast Acquired, which is now bringing in $35,000 in subscription fees through Glow, and has since signed up shows including Techmeme Ride Home, Twenty Thousand Hertz and The Newsworthy. Co-founder and CEO Amira Valliani — who previously worked in the Obama White House and earned an MBA from Wharton — says the product was born from her own difficulty finding a sustainable business model for a local elections podcast. Glow views hosting as largely solved and is initially focused on solving monetization via direct listener relationships, with potential future work on distribution defined as audience growth support rather than a new podcast app. The company plans to use its seed funding to build the product and invest in podcast success, including hiring a dedicated podcast success hire as its first post-round addition.
